Arthur H. Stolba

January 26, 1923 - November 14, 2005

Arthur H. StolbaFuneral service for Arthur H. Stolba, 82, of S. Spring Garden Avenue, DeLand, who died Monday, November 14, 2005, will be 1 p.m. Friday, November 18, at Lankford Funeral Home, 220 E. New York Ave., DeLand. Calling hours will be from 2 p.m. until 4 p.m. and 6 p.m. until 8 p.m. Thursday, November 17.

Mr. Stolba was born in Queens, NY and moved here in 1960 from Sanford. He was retired as a chief petty officer, serving in World War II. He was a member of the Loyal Order of Moose, VFW, Eagles and the AMVETS, all of DeLand. He was also a member of the Fleet Reserve, Sanford.

He was preceded in death by his wife, Lucille, and a grandson, George Shelton, Jr. Survivors include his daughter and son-in-law, Donna and Jack Hood, DeLand; three granddaughters, Patricia Gill of Fairbanks, Alaska, Charlotte Horton of Augusta, GA and April Strunks of Piqua, Ohio and four great-grandchildren.
